Aldéric Lecluse is a scholar working on Physiology,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. According to data from OpenAlex, Aldéric Lecluse has authored 3 papers receiving a total of 6 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 1 paper in Physiology, 1 paper in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and 1 paper in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. Recurrent topics in Aldéric Lecluse’s work include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(1 paper), Advanced MRI Techniques and Applications (1 paper) and Ultrasound Imaging and Elastography (1 paper). Aldéric Lecluse is often cited by papers focused on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(1 paper), Advanced MRI Techniques and Applications (1 paper) and Ultrasound Imaging and Elastography (1 paper). Aldéric Lecluse collaborates with scholars based in France. Aldéric Lecluse's co-authors include S. Willoteaux, Christine Cavaro‐Ménard, Jean-Baptiste Fasquel, Valérie Chauviré, Adriana Prundean, Christophe Verny, Anne Caignard, Sophie Godard, Franck Letournel and Philippe Codron and has published in prestigious journals such as Brain Pathology, Computers in Biology and Medicine and Revue Neurologique.
